Birmingham has a long cinematic history; the Electric Cinema on Station Street is the oldest working cinema in the UK,[226] and Oscar Deutsch opened his first Odeon cinema in Perry Barr during the 1920s. With 87.92 recorded offences per 1000 population in 200910, Birmingham's crime rate is above the average for England and Wales, but lower than any of England's other major core cities and lower than many smaller cities such as Oxford, Cambridge or Brighton. Despite the industrialisation of subsequent centuries this role has been retained and the Birmingham Wholesale Markets remain the largest combined wholesale food markets in the country,[219] selling meat, fish, fruit, vegetables and flowers and supplying fresh produce to restauranteurs and independent retailers from as far as 100 miles away. Thinktank is Birmingham's main science museum, with a Giant Screen cinema, a planetarium and a collection that includes the Smethwick Engine, the world's oldest working steam engine. Notably, Birmingham saw the first ever use of radiography in an operation,[191] and the UK's first ever hole-in-the-heart operation was performed at Birmingham Children's Hospital. Railways arrived in Birmingham in 1837 with the arrival of the Grand Junction Railway and, a year later, the London and Birmingham Railway.
